From paper folder to one basketball app

A clear path for UK basketball teams moving off printouts and chat chaos into Run5, without pausing fixtures or chasing the roster again.

Most basketball programs do not wake up digital. They inherit a folder: printed rosters, handwritten scores, fee notes in a thread, licence scans in email. The move to an app fails when it asks coaches to pause the season for a migration project.

Run5 is designed for the opposite: start with the next practice, not a six week IT plan.

Step one: create the team and invite the roster

Set name, colours and crest. Invite with a code or share link so players complete their own profiles. Staff roles and assistants can join as the program grows. You stop retyping jersey numbers from last year’s PDF.

Step two: post fixtures and collect RSVPs

Games and training sit on a shared calendar. Players answer Yes, Maybe or No, with late, limited and injured options. Coaches see the attendee list and squad size warnings before tip, not after the warm up.

Step three: put fees where everyone can see them

Season fees, bank details and unique references replace “who paid?” arguments. Players claim payments. Coaches confirm or reject. Reminders and extra requests for kit or trips stay in the same system.

How Run5 solves it: the handoff is operational, not theoretical. Create team, invite roster, post game, open Live Game Stats. The folder becomes backup, not the operating system.

Step four: score live and keep the season alive

Paper scoresheets end the story at the final whistle. Run5 continues it: box score, period scores, season leaderboards and form. The next coach or committee inherits history instead of starting from blank cells.
